Forced evictions are at the heart of most African land disputes, and anger over those displacements threatens investment across the continent. An international discussion on Land tenure, risk for investors and political stability in Africa has been held in Senegal's capital, Dakar. Some of the issues discussed include land rights and their impact on peace and prosperity on the continent. Research shows that 63 percent of land disputes focus on cases of people driven off their land, often to make room for private development projects.
